Hiking around Drontermeer offers routes through a landscape characterized by its border lake scenery, polder views, and interconnected waterways. The region features diverse terrain including dense forests, open meadows, and gentle hills. These natural features provide varied backdrops for exploration, with paths often following the lake's shores. The area's low elevation gain makes most trails accessible for a wide range of hikers.

What are some notable landmarks or points of interest to see while hiking?

While hiking around Drontermeer, you can encounter several interesting landmarks. The modern Reevesluis lock complex is a significant attraction, offering great views and a beautiful resting point. You might also pass by the Drontermeer Lock or enjoy views from the Elburg Bridge. The nearby old Hanseatic city of Elburg is also a worthwhile detour.

Are there options for longer, more challenging hikes?

Yes, for hikers looking for a longer experience, there are moderate trails that offer extended exploration. The Nieuwendijk – Reevediep Bridge loop from Roggebotsluis is a moderate 10.6-mile (17.0 km) path that provides extensive views along the water and connects to the Reevesluis area, offering a more substantial trek.
